Hi,
I have a large amount of data downloaded from a banking system which I would like to transpose, however as there are hundreds suppliers I don't want to repeat the transpose action for every single one. Can someone help me with this? Below is how it is: [RECIPIENT AMTSGERICHT LUNEBURG] ACCOUNTNO 106024003 BANKCODE 25050000 NAME AMTSGERICHT LUNEBURG PURPOSE NZS LG - 15553 [RECIPIENT E.ON BAYERN AG] ACCOUNTNO 62004312 BANKCODE 70020270 NAME E.ON BAYERN AG PURPOSE INVOICES 690011186888-07060#9 DEC, 690011026217-070426 #DEC [RECIPIENT DETEKTEI EISEN] ACCOUNTNO 311005448 BANKCODE 44050199 NAME DETEKTEI EISEN PURPOSE INVOICE 1206 [RECIPIENT ASTERIA GV GMBH] ACCOUNTNO 377978000 BANKCODE 21050000 NAME ASTERIA GV GMBH PURPOSE NEBENKOSTEN 2007/2008#CGV KUENZELSAU [RECIPIENT ENSEL-NT GMBH] ACCOUNTNO 6611750 BANKCODE 56051790 NAME ENSEL-NT GMBH PURPOSE 6825936 This is how I would like it: ACCOUNTNO BANKCODE NAME 106024003 25050000 AMTSGERICHT LUNEBURG 62004312 70020270 E.ON BAYERN AG Many thanks! |
